Volkswagen Polo Service & Repair Manual: Battery Tester Charger Kit -GRX3000VAS- General Description

Only Volkswagen approved chargers may be used to charge batteries in Volkswagen vehicles. Only the Battery Tester Charger Kit -GRX3000VAS- charger is used in the USA and Canada.
The Battery Tester Charger Kit -GRX3000VAS- battery charger combines battery charging with checking the charge level and testing the battery.
The following charging and analysis procedures apply to all batteries, all battery installed locations (engine compartment or luggage compartment) and all battery designated usage (for the starter or for the second/convenience battery).
Always follow the Safety Precautions, the instructions for setting up the battery charger, the display menu/display buttons, LEDs and the procedures in the Battery Tester Charger Kit -GRX3000VAS- Operating Instructions.
Carefully read the Battery Tester Charger Kit -GRX3000VAS- Operating Instructions.
Refer to Self Study Program - Vehicle Batteries for more information.
  WARNING
Risk of injury. Follow all Warnings and Safety Precautions. Refer to → Chapter „Warnings and Safety Precautions“.
Keep open flame or sparks away from the batteries and do not smoke.
The battery charger must be switched off whenever connecting or disconnect the cable.
Do not remove the plugs while charging.
Overcharging sulfated batteries can cause an explosion.
Precision tools may not be kept in areas where batteries are charged. Chemical reactions can lead to corrosion.
  WARNING
Batteries that have a light yellow visual indicator do not have to be tested or charged. Jump starting must not be used!
There is a risk of explosion during testing, charging or jump starting.
These batteries must be replaced.
